On the afternoon of October 2, the Hanoi Department of Education and Training launched the Lifelong Learning Response Week 2023 with the theme "Building self-learning capacity in the digital age".
The five messages sent at the Launching Ceremony include: “Lifelong learning - The key to all success”; “Self-learning must be the core of learning”; “Self-learning is a way to build a learning society”; “Digital transformation and lifelong learning opportunities for everyone”; “Digital transformation to successfully build a new learning society”.
Director of the Hanoi Department of Education and Training Tran The Cuong said that implementing digital transformation in education is considered one of the key tasks and top priorities of the country. The Government and departments and sectors have created the necessary conditions for the development of digital transformation in education, ensuring that all citizens have the opportunity to study regularly and learn for life, thereby building a learning society.
“Lifelong learning has long been of special interest to the world because it is an essential need of humans and society. Now, in the face of the Fourth Industrial Revolution, that need is even more urgent,” Mr. Tran The Cuong emphasized.
The Director of the Hanoi Department of Education and Training said that in order to meet the self-study needs of all people, in our country, digital transformation still faces many difficulties and challenges. Therefore, the education sector needs to come up with long-term solutions and strategies with a specific roadmap to effectively support lifelong learning for all people on the digital technology platform. In particular, a typical solution is to raise awareness of the importance of digital transformation in education; encourage and support the application of new education and training models based on digital platforms; create equal learning opportunities between regions with different socio-economic conditions, and mobilize social resources to participate in implementation.
In addition, the sector needs to complete the database in education; form a digital learning resource warehouse, open learning resource warehouse for the whole sector, link with international learning resource warehouses, meet the needs of self-study, lifelong learning, narrow the gap between regions; build network infrastructure, technology equipment. At the same time, the sector focuses on training and fostering a team with knowledge, skills in information technology, information security to operate in the digital environment, meeting the requirements of digital transformation...
